我想用下面的代码读取 XML 文件,但 XML 文件没有传递给parsexml
函数并加载错误函数。请帮助我为什么不成功。
$(document).delegate('div .myBtn', 'click', function () {
var current_data = "../aa.xml";
$.ajax({
type: "GET",
url: current_data,
dataType: "xml",
success: parseXML,
error: function (jqXHR, textStatus, errorThrown) {
alert(JSON.stringify(jqXHR));
alert("AJAX error: " + textStatus + ' : ' + errorThrown);
}
});
$("#myModal").css("display", "block");
});
function parseXML(xml) {
alert("okkkkkkkkk");
var details = xml.getElementsByTagName("book");
for (var i = 0; i < details.length; i++) {
.
.
.
});
我的代码有什么问题?